Output 3dd70706ac1ec601970ce21bfb3ebb2933fbaa1091b2f360ff72c37e4fd44d57:2
- value
- 28907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63d2531d1c7b4815aaaedc5d58f915eda5222e8a OP_EQUAL
- address
- 3Anpn9acqkyjr9g5UCgLqf7BXRkgtkG88U
- transaction
- 3dd70706ac1ec601970ce21bfb3ebb2933fbaa1091b2f360ff72c37e4fd44d57